Description
Manzanar is photographed with incarcerees walking between barracks and latrine buildings. Caption beneath photograph reads, "Manzanar center view, Barracks on either sides of the latrine-shower, laundry and ironing bldgs. Double barrack right, is the mess hall. Taken for Christmas 1943." Colorized photograph from "Seiko Ishida's photo album" (csufu_sc_0364), page 84. The Japanese American Relocation Collection is composed of ephemera related to the relocation program during World War II. Items include the official government report of Manzanar Relocation Center, a photo album, post-war activism materials related to preserving and remembering the camps, various clippings, and documents. The strength of this collection is found in its many perspectives on the controversial relocation program and how it has been presented since World War II.
